SUMMARY
`kholidays` currently flags both Good Friday & Easter Sunday as public holidays in Ireland (Republic). However, these are not public holidays. See also:
- https://www.citizensinformation.ie/en/employment/employment-rights-and-conditions/leave-and-holidays/public-holidays/
- https://publicholidays.ie/

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Launch KOrganizer.
2. In the drop-down menus: Settings > Configure KOrganizer.
3. In the "Holidays" pane of "Time and Date" tab select "Ireland (English)" from the drop down-menu.

OBSERVED RESULT
KOrganizer populates the Irish public holidays, but includes Good Friday & Easter Sunday.

EXPECTED RESULT
KOrganizer populates the Irish public holidays, but does not include Good Friday & Easter Sunday.
